Output 1c62f205bcc7b261a60dfcba874a34e12efe33acf8f86e1f6c6a1747c086569f:75

value
70897630
script pubkey
OP_0 OP_PUSHBYTES_20 37fdeaf558fffe119c9d649f58a095da90633ff0
address
bc1qxl774a2clllpr8yavj043gy4m2gxx0lsfd34xz
transaction
1c62f205bcc7b261a60dfcba874a34e12efe33acf8f86e1f6c6a1747c086569f
spent
true